Abstract

The present invention relates to a kind of hot water taking devices more particularly to a kind of hot water taking device for medical unit for medical treatment.Technical problems to be solved:Hot water taking, the hot water taking device for medical unit easy to use, safe and reliable can largely be filled by providing one kind.Technical solution is:A kind of hot water taking device for medical unit includes incubator, outlet pipe, the first valve, movable plate, universal wheel, idler wheel, side plate, big connecting shaft, exhaust pipe, the second valve, connecting tube, gasket etc.;Outlet pipe is located at the left side of incubator, and outlet pipe is connected with the lower part of incubator left side wall, and outlet pipe is connected with incubator, and the first valve is provided on outlet pipe.A kind of hot water taking device for medical unit provided by the present invention, hot water taking can be largely filled, water heater there dress hot water taking is repeatedly removed without inpatient and entourage, saves a large amount of time for inpatient and entourage, it is easy to use, securely and reliably.

Because the present invention includes incubator, outlet pipe, the first valve, movable plate, universal wheel, idler wheel, side plate, big connection Axis, exhaust pipe, the second valve, connecting tube, gasket, hose, get water bucket, cabinet, slim slide block, tooth plate, gear wheel, the first rotation Axis, bracket, holding rod, fixed block and the first long bolt, so ten thousand can be passed through when patient or entourage need to fill hot water taking To wheel and idler wheel, the present invention is moved to hospital's water heater position, universal wheel can be turned to flexibly, and the present invention is mobile To after hospital's water heater position, gear wheel can be rotated by holding rod, gear wheel band moving tooth plate is transported upwards Dynamic, so that tooth plate drives cabinet, get water bucket and hose to be moved upwards, while cabinet drives connecting tube to carry out in large through-hole Sliding, gasket can prevent hot water from leaking out, and when cabinet is driven position corresponding to water heater tap, stop to canine tooth Then the rotation of wheel screws the first long bolt, so that tooth plate be fixed, then get water bucket is pulled out out of cabinet, Slim slide block provides auxiliary for the pulling of get water bucket, and hose provides convenience for the pull-out of get water bucket, when get water bucket is drawn to hot water After immediately below device tap, the second valve is opened, then opens water heater tap, hot water is flowed into get water bucket, then is passed through Hose and connecting tube flow downwardly into incubator, after hot water fills, close water heater tap, get water bucket is pushed back case In vivo, then by the first long bolt unscrew, under the effect of gravity, tooth plate drives cabinet to move downward, and cabinet drives downwards connecting tube It resets, while the interior bottom connection of the lower end of connecting tube and incubator touches, and prevents hot gas from emerging, then again closes the second valve It closes, then the present invention is back into ward, when hot water is needed, open the first valve, hot water is flowed out by outlet pipe.
Because further include have first bevel gear, second bevel gear, long connecting shaft, small bearing bracket, casing, big positioning screw, Big bearing block, third hand tap gear and the 4th bevel gear, so when needing the present invention being moved to hospital water heater position, First big positioning screw can be screwed, long connecting shaft is fixed in casing by big positioning screw, to lead to as the mobile present invention Crossing idler wheel drives big connecting shaft and the 4th bevel gear to be rotated, and the 4th bevel gear drives third hand tap gear rotation, triconodont Wheel drives long connecting shaft to be rotated by casing, and long connecting shaft drives first bevel gear to be rotated by second bevel gear, First bevel gear drives gear wheel to be rotated by the first rotary shaft, and gear wheel band moving tooth plate is moved upwards, thus In moving process of the present invention, tooth plate is able to drive cabinet, get water bucket and hose and is moved upwards, arrives and heat when driving cabinet When the corresponding position of hydrophone tap, then first stop motion is screwed the first long bolt, so that tooth plate be consolidated It is fixed, then big positioning screw is unscrewed, casing and long connecting shaft are detached from and fix, and are further continued for pushing the present invention, thus will not It drives long connecting shaft to be rotated, band moving tooth plate will not be moved again, more time saving and energy saving, descending operation is more convenient fast It is prompt.
Because further including having the first connecting plate, the second connecting plate, cylinder body, flabellum, the second rotary shaft, swivel bearing, Dalian Fishplate bar and rotating disk, so can first be opened the first valve when needing quickly to cool down to hot water, pass through outlet pipe stream Enter into cylinder body, close the first valve, then by rotating to rotating disk, rotating disk drives flabellum by the second rotary shaft It is rotated, flabellum carries out pectinid, can accelerate cylinder intracorporal hot water cooling, after cooling, by cylinder body from the second connecting plate On take away, drink more safe ready.
Because further including having rotating electric machine, the 5th bevel gear and the 6th bevel gear, when needs quickly carry out hot water When cooling, it can star rotating electric machine and operated, rotating electric machine drives the 6th bevel gear to be rotated by the 5th bevel gear, 6th bevel gear drives rotating disk to be rotated, so that manual hand manipulation is replaced using rotating electric machine, more time saving and energy saving, drop Temp effect is faster and better.
Because further including having pushing hands, the second long bolt and briquetting, when needing to push the present invention, Ke Yitong It crosses pushing hands to be moved, when needing to brake, the second long bolt can be screwed, the second long bolt drives briquetting to push down idler wheel, To brake using frictional force, prevent the present invention from tampering, it is more firm to place, and security performance is higher.
Beneficial effects of the present invention:A kind of hot water taking device for medical unit provided by the present invention, Neng Gou great Amount dress hot water taking repeatedly removes water heater there dress hot water taking without inpatient and entourage, for inpatient and the people that accompanies and attends to Member saves a large amount of time, easy to use, securely and reliably, is conducive to the personal safety for protecting patient and entourage, Structure is simple, maintenance easy to maintain.
